Bac Giang plans to build 13 golf courses

The northern province of Bac Giang has planned to build 13 golf courses by 2030 and a vision until 2050, said Duong Van Thai, the provincial party secretary.

Under the prime minister’s approval, Bac Giang will be an industrial province and listed among 15 cities and provinces with the highest gross regional domestic product. Golf courses are intended to spur tourism development.

According to Thai, most of the 13 planned golf courses are located in the provincial key economic areas and tourist sites.

The largest golf course which covers 189.95 hectares will be built in Tien Phong Commune in Yen Dung District, followed by two 180-hectare golf courses in Yen The District and Son Dong District. The other ones will have an area of from 75.38 to 150 hectares.

Thai added that Bac Giang will use mountainous land for building golf courses, not agricultural land. Currently, around 30,000 foreign experts are working in Bac Giang and its neighbouring province of Bac Ninh.

Vietnam now has around 80 golf courses. He noted that the golf course development could help generate more jobs for people. Each golf course may employ 500 people.

Located in the Lang Son-Hanoi-Hai Phong-Quang Ninh economic corridor and bestowed with stunning natural landscapes like Tay Yen Tu Natural Reserve, Khe Ro primaeval forest, Dong Cao plateau, and Khuon Than lake, Bac Giang Province has huge tourism potential.
